The Traditional Ruler of Nnewi, Igwe Dr. Kenneth Onyeneke Orizu (III) has endorsed the expansion plan of Innoson Vehicle Manufacturing (IVM) Company at its new site located at Umuezena Community in Umudim Nnewi, Anambra State.
Endorsing the expansion plan, on Tuesday, Igwe Kenneth Orizu commended the Chief Executive Officer of Innoson Vehicles, Chief Innocent Chukwma (Ifediaso Nnewi) for seeing the need to build the extension of the factory in Nnewi.
He said that the expansion plan of Innoson Vehicle Manufacturing (IVM) will bring more development to Nnewi especially in the expansion of economic activities.
The Igwe noted that the expansion will also generate direct and indirect employment opportunities within Nnewi and environs, which will further bring Nnewi to the limelight.
The Monarch emphasised that since his ascendancy to the throne, he has continued to advocate for think-home philosophy among Nnewi indigene who plans to make any investment.
Inspecting the progress of work in the new site, Igwe Nnewi blessed the new site, praying that Innoson Vehicle Manufacturing (IVM) will continue to improve in all standards.
On his own part, Chief Dr. Innocent Chukwuma appreciated Igwe Dr. Kenneth Onyeneke Orizu (III) for his prayers and encouragement, stating that despite the offers he got from different parts of the country for the building of the extension of the factory, he insisted that building the extension in Nnewi is the best bet.
Chief Chukwuma assured Igwe Nnewi and his entourage that he will continue to do everything possible to ensure that Nnewi is developed further.
